WebTIPS FOR PAIRING FOOD AND WINE TIP 1 Know the flavor components of your food and wine: sweet, salty, bitter, acidic, fatty, or spicy. TIP 2 Create balance with complementary and contrasting flavor profiles. TIP 3 The bitterness in red wines go great with bold meats, while the acidity of white wine pairs best with lighter meats. Another and broader way to combine food and wine is to create a congruent or contrasting flavor pairing. A congruent pairing creates an amplification of the shared flavor compounds in a food and wine, for example buttered popcorn with an oaky buttery chardonnay.
